    District Information

    Please give a brief description of your district: After recent redistricting, CA-51 is now the lone congressional district that stretches along California's entire southern 170 mile border with Mexico.

    Percentage of Democratic, Republican, and Unaffiliated Voters: D-49.7%, R-20.6%, U-25.3%
